The Crucial Role of Compactors in Foundation Construction
When constructing a new structure, the foundation is absolutely vital. A solid structure ensures your building can withstand the test of time and the elements. Therefore compactors come into play. These powerful machines are essential for forming a stable and reliable base, making them an crucial part of any construction project.
Compactors work by applying pressure to the soil, packing it tightly together. This process removes air pockets and voids, causing a stronger and more stable foundation. Ultimately, compactors are your key to a strong and durable building that can stand the test of time.
